Good day,

I have an excel document that I need import into SAS OnDemand. How do I import it?

I also need to extract the first 50 rows from it, how should I do it?

Generic steps:
1. Upload excel file to onDemand
2. Import file
3. Filter out for only 50 rows

The courses and video's above cover all three tasks.
